Royal Scandal Casts Doubt on Princesses’ Wedding Attendance

Published on

Princesses Beatrice and Eugenie are reconsidering their attendance at their cousin Peter Phillips’ upcoming wedding in June following new revelations concerning their father,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or. Thames Valley Police recently expanded their inquiry into the former prince after allegations surfaced regarding his inappropriate behavior towards a woman at Royal Ascot in 2002.

The scrutiny surrounding Andrew has once again placed his daughters in the public eye, with Beatrice and Eugenie initially scheduled to participate in the Royal Family’s gathering in Cirencester on June 6 to celebrate Peter Phillips and Harriet Sperling’s wedding. However, with Andrew entangled in another scandal, a royal expert suggests that the princesses’ presence at the wedding remains uncertain.

According to Tom Sykes for The Royalist, Beatrice and Eugenie are deeply affected by the latest developments involving their father and are reluctant to draw attention away from the bride and groom on their special day. A source indicated that the princesses are undecided about attending the private ceremony, emphasizing that their attendance was never confirmed.

The source also indicated that Beatrice and Eugenie may opt to skip Royal Ascot later this summer to maintain a low profile amidst their parents’ ongoing controversies. While The Royalist insider believes the princesses will likely miss Peter Phillips’ wedding, former BBC royal correspondent Jennie Bond asserts that the cousins share a close bond and the Royal Family is committed to maintaining a positive relationship with them.

Jennie expressed to the Mirror that any potential presence of Beatrice and Eugenie at the wedding would generate some interest but should not overshadow the couple’s celebration. She emphasized that Peter would not want the alleged actions of Andrew and Sarah to affect their daughters, who have not faced any accusations.

Jennie further stated that the princesses are enduring a challenging period in their lives, and their extended family is resolute in ensuring their continual inclusion. Thames Valley Police confirmed their ongoing investigation into allegations of inappropriate conduct by Andrew at Royal Ascot in 2002, stating that all reasonable leads are being pursued.
